David HODGETT (Croydon) (14:28): (22) My question is for the Minister for Transport and Infrastructure, and the question I ask is: Minister, when will the Cardigan Road, Mooroolbark, storage site, presently being used by the level crossing removal authority to store materials, be closed for good? As the minister knows, the Mooroolbark and Lilydale level crossings were removed in recent years, and the Croydon and Ringwood East crossings have now commenced the removal process. The Level Crossing Removal Project team have advised residents in Mooroolbark that the storage site on Cardigan Road, Mooroolbark, will be accessed 24/7 for the next three months to store materials from the Mont Albert and Surrey Hills projects, increasing the number of trucks travelling down already congested local roads and disturbing the peace for locals at all hours of the night and day. Minister, to provide some assurance of when this continual disruption will end, please advise when this site will be closed.
